MARLIN, MARLIN AND MORE MARLIN!

The Pemba Channel is lifting with striped marlin and the sea is a beautiful colour with lovely rips. There are plenty of bait fish close in plus lots of flying fish and squid further out. Most of the marlin are striped marlin averaging 50-70 kg but there are a few blues and blacks. Many of the striped marlin are in packs and often seen tailing on the surface. (more…)
